Efton Chism prioritizes mental growth as Patriots enter training camp
Yahoo Sports • 1 min read • Latest: Aug 1, 2026, 10:00 AM
Last updated Aug 1, 2026
Efton Chism III, wide receiver for the New England Patriots, focuses on mental development ahead of his second NFL season. After making the 53-man roster as an undrafted rookie free agent, Chism aims to improve his understanding of playbook details and game strategies. His wide receiver coach, Todd Downing, noted Chism's progress during minicamp, particularly in recognizing concepts without hesitation. The competition for places in the Patriots' receiver group has intensified with new additions A.J. Brown and Romeo Doubs. Chism remains optimistic about the team's environment and the impact of competition on player improvement.
